Pirate's Pantry Spring 2023 Update
Starting this semester, Spring 2023, all students participating in the assistance
programs offered through Pirate's Pantry will be required to fill out a short online
application. This will allow us to assess needs, track inventory and better serve students with
resources. Learn more about how MJC can help.
The application is open from now and provides access to programs such as:
- Grocery Appointments; Drive-thru or Pantry Visits
- Pantry Pop-Up Stations East/ West
- On-the-go Snacks and Drinks
- Food Services Vouchers
- Personal Care and Hygiene products
- Cal Fresh Application Assistance

Renew your CADAA- Applications Open
The California Dream Act Application opened on October 1st. Students who are eligible to apply for the CADAA should apply by the March 2nd deadline. Completing and submitting the CADAA is free. MJC Student Financial Services is offering workshop to help you through the process.
It's time to renew your Financial Aid Application (FAFSA)
You can afford college. Begin by applying for Federal student aid by completing the 2023-2024 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A). Completing and submitting the FAFSA is free. The application is now available online. Priority deadline is March 2, 2023. MJC Student Financial Services is offering workshops to help you through the process.
